Types of UK Driving Licenses
Provisionary License: This is the initial action towards acquiring a complete driving license. A provisionary license enables individuals to drive under certain restrictions, usually needing the supervision of a knowledgeable driver.
Full Car License: Once individuals pass the driving test, they are awarded a full car license, permitting them to drive vehicles and small vans.
Motorcycle License: This license enables the holder to operate motorcycles, with different classifications based on the engine size and power of the bike.
Bus and Lorry License: For individuals intending to drive larger automobiles, such as buses and trucks, a specific license must be obtained, that includes extra training and screening.
Specialized Licenses: There are also licenses for special automobile classifications, consisting of farming cars and taxis.
Action 1: Obtain a Provisional License
The primary step in the licensing procedure is requesting a provisionary license. This can be done online or through a paper application. Applicants need to:
- Be at least 15 years and 9 months old.
- Offer valid identification.
- Pay a cost (presently ₤ 34 for online applications and ₤ 43 for paper applications).
Step 2: Prepare for the Driving Test
After getting a provisional license, the next step is to get ready for the driving test. This typically includes:
- Driving Lessons: It is suggested to take lessons from a certified driving trainer, who can direct learners on safe driving practices and help them acquire self-confidence on the road.
- Theory Test Preparation: The theory test evaluates knowledge in areas such as road signs, traffic laws, and threat perception. Lots of resources are offered, consisting of apps and online simulations.
Action 3: Take the Theory Test
Prospects must pass the theory test before they can book a driving test. The theory test includes multiple-choice questions and a hazard understanding section. This test is essential for evaluating a driver's understanding of the guidelines and risks on the roadway.
Step 4: Take the Practical Driving Test
When the theory test has actually been passed, people can reserve their practical driving test. The test evaluates driving skills in real-world scenarios, consisting of:
- Driving safely and with confidence on different kinds of roads.
- Performing driving maneuvers (parking, reversing, etc).
- Adhering to traffic laws.
Step 5: Obtain Your Full License
Upon successfully passing the practical driving test, candidates are issued a full driving license. They require to obtain a license upgrade, which generally happens immediately as part of the driving test process.
